"teet" meaning in Scots

See teet in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Adjective

Forms: mair teet [comparative], maist teet [superlative]
Head templates: {{head|sco|adjective|comparative|mair teet|||||superlative|maist teet||||}} teet (comparative mair teet, superlative maist teet), {{sco-adj}} teet (comparative mair teet, superlative maist teet)
  1. swift, quick, fast, faird.
